What Exactly Is an Automotive Assembly Line Video?

Simply put: it’s a visual recording that documents the entire or partial process of building a vehicle in an assembly line—think step-by-step choreography filmed from multiple angles, highlighting parts installation, testing stages, or robotic automation. They’re not just for show either—they’re used internally for:

  • Employee training and refresher courses
  • Process optimization and troubleshooting
  • Supplier quality verification
  • Marketing and client demonstrations

Because car manufacturing is such a high-stakes, high-precision activity, having a detailed video walkthrough means fewer mistakes, greater transparency, and faster innovation adoption.

Core Components of Effective Automotive Assembly Line Videos

1. Clarity & Resolution

Low-quality or blurry footage doesn't cut it here. Most modern videos are shot in at least 4K to capture sharp and precise movements. This is crucial when inspecting small components or torque applications, where every millimeter counts.

2. Multi-Angle Coverage

One camera simply won’t capture the complexity. By using multiple synchronized angles—including overhead drone shots, close-ups, and wide factory floor footage—these videos give a holistic view of the process, making it easier to analyze and train accordingly.

3. Synchronization With Process Data

Increasingly, videos include embedded or overlaid data like cycle times, torque specs, or temperature readings from sensors. This fusion of visual and quantitative info gives engineers an edge in pinpointing inefficiencies.

4. Annotation & Commentary

An industrial video without labels is like a map without markers. Clear annotations, voiceover commentary, or even subtitles make videos accessible to diverse teams and international audiences.

5. Accessibility & Format

Videos designed to be shareable across devices—mobile phones, VR headsets, desktop monitors—help frontline workers access training on the go, bridging the gap between theory and hands-on practice.

6. Up-to-Date Content

Given the pace of innovation, videos need constant updates matching evolving production lines or new technologies, which can otherwise cause confusion or outdated training.

Innovations on the Horizon

The future of automotive assembly line videos is tightly coupled with digital transformation. Augmented and virtual reality are already starting to create immersive training environments, enabling workers to "walk through" assembly stations without leaving their desks. Artificial intelligence is being harnessed for real-time defect detection, even as drones and robotic camera arms capture footage from angles impossible before.

Sustainability is another big driver, with companies aiming to slash carbon footprints by analyzing line energy consumption through video-based sensors. Plus, green energy-driven factories mean assembly line videos can track their environmental impact directly.

Roadblocks and How Industry is Tackling Them

Despite all these advances, there are still challenges. Privacy concerns around recording employees, data security for video feeds, and the cost of high-end equipment can slow adoption. In addition, outdated infrastructure in some plants inhibits smooth integration.

Experts suggest adopting modular and scalable video solutions to ease upgrades and employing encrypted cloud platforms to enhance security. Plus, some companies are combining these videos with automotive assembly line video case studies for practical learning—kind of bridging theory and practice.
